+# Tests for target-local variables, such as ${.TARGET} or $@. These variables
+# are relatively short-lived as they are created just before making the
+# target. In contrast, global variables are typically created when the
+# makefiles are read in.
+#
+# The 7 built-in target-local variables are listed in the manual page. They
+# are defined just before the target is actually made. Additional
+# target-local variables can be defined in dependency lines like
+# 'target: VAR=value', one at a time.

+# The target-local variables can be used in expressions, just like other
+# variables. When these expressions are evaluated outside of a target, these
+# expressions are not yet expanded, instead their text is preserved, to allow
+# these expressions to expand right in time when the target-local variables
+# are actually set.
+#
+# Conditions like the ones below are evaluated in the scope of the command
+# line, which means that variables from the command line, from the global
+# scope and from the environment are resolved, in this order (but see the
+# command line option '-e'). In that phase, expressions involving
+# target-local variables need to be preserved, including the exact names of
+# the variables.
+#
+# Each of the built-in target-local variables has two equivalent names, for
+# example '@' is equivalent to '.TARGET'. The implementation might
# canonicalize these aliases at some point, and that might be surprising.
# This aliasing happens for single-character variable names like $@ or $<
# (see VarFind, CanonicalVarname), but not for braced or parenthesized
# expressions like ${@}, ${.TARGET} ${VAR:Mpattern} (see Var_Parse,
# ParseVarname).
+#
+# In the following condition, make does not expand '$@' but instead changes it
+# to the long-format alias '$(.TARGET)'; note that the alias is not written
+# with braces, as would be common in BSD makefiles, but with parentheses.
+# This alternative form behaves equivalently though.

+# If the sources of a dependency line look like a variable assignment, make
+# treats them as such. There is only a single variable assignment per
+# dependency line, which makes whitespace around the assignment operator
+# irrelevant.

+# Assignments using '+=' do *not* look up the global value, instead they only
+# look up the variable in the target's own scope.
+var-scope-local-append.o: VAR+= local
+# Once a variable is defined in the target-local scope, appending using '+='
+# behaves as expected. Note that the expression '${.TARGET}' is not resolved
+# when parsing the dependency line, its evaluation is deferred until the
+# target is actually made.
+# expect: : Making var-scope-local-append.o with VAR="local to var-scope-local-append.o".
+var-scope-local-append.o: VAR += to ${.TARGET}
+# To access the value of a global variable, use a variable expression. This
+# expression is expanded before parsing the whole dependency line. Since the
+# expansion happens to the right of both the dependency operator ':' and also
+# to the right of the assignment operator '=', the expanded text does not
+# affect the dependency or the variable assignment structurally. The
+# effective variable assignment, after expanding the whole line first, is thus
+# 'VAR= global+local'.
